Reporting to the Director of Operations, the Temporary Facilities / Construction Project Manager oversees and coordinates facility related construction and installation activities. This role manages contractors, supervises the movement, shipment, and installation of equipment, and ensures all work complies with permitting, safety, and utility requirements. The position requires broad knowledge of construction practices, general contracting, utilities infrastructure, and facility operations.
This is a fixed-term role specifically tied to the project's duration, which is expected to conclude within ~18 to 24 months.
